From carbon-copy receipts and zip-zap machines to mag stripes, chip and PIN, contactless and mobile wallets, payment tech keeps evolving, and attackers evolve right alongside it. Felix sits down with Gareth, a payments industry veteran of 30 years, to unpack the real hardware attack surface: skimmers in stripe readers, ATM overlays, contactless relay tricks, and why static QR codes are basically begging to be abused. They also dig into why raising contactless limits changes theft economics, how phone theft turns into credential theft, and why the EU Cyber Resilience Act means you need to think about hardware security now.
